The DeKalb County school board on Wednesday called a meeting for 10:30 a.m. Thursday.

The board is scheduled to vote on two personnel cases presented by the legal affairs office and on state mandated training for school board members.

The meeting follows a 10 a.m. executive session for personnel issues. The meeting is at system headquarters, 1701 Mountain Industrial Boulevard, Stone Mountain.
